Location


Located in Cirencester, Wild Thyme & Honey is in a rural location, within a 5-minute drive of New Brewery Arts Centre and Church of St John the Baptist. This hotel is 11.8 mi (18.9 km) from Thames River and 15.9 mi (25.5 km) from Cotswold Wildlife Park and Gardens.

Facilities


Take in the views from a terrace and a garden and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access. This hotel also features concierge services, wedding services, and a banquet hall.

Business Facilities


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k and luggage storage. Free self parking is available onsite.

Dining


Enjoy a satisfying meal at Crown at Ampney Brook serving guests of Wild Thyme & Honey.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. English breakfasts are available daily from 8:00 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ee.

Rooms


Treat yourself to a stay in one of the 24 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ring heated floors.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ming is available for your entertainment.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, and housekeeping is provided daily.

Stayed in the superior suite (London Rd no3), and although the hotel was lovely I found hairs all over the bath, the mattress and the pillows. When I pulled back sheet on the bed there were crumbs over the sheet and a dead insect. I also found urine stains on the mattress. The fridge also had stagnant water in and smelled really strongly of fish every time it was opened. When I emailed the general manager he took a week to respond and simply offered 25% off a return stay. Unfortunately I would not stay here again due to the cleanliness. As this was a £600 a night room I was really disappointed.
